Bacon-Wrapped Dried Apricots

  • Level: Easy
  • Yield: 12 servings
  • Total: 15 min
  • Active: 15 min
Advertisement

Ingredients

12 large dried apricots

12 smoked almonds 

4 slices bacon, cut crosswise into thirds 

1/2 tablespoon maple syrup 

1 teaspoon red wine vinegar 

Freshly ground black pepper 

1 teaspoon chopped chives, for garnish 

Directions

  1. Gently separate the two sides of each apricot and stuff with the almonds. Wrap each with a segment of the bacon. Arrange in a small nonstick skillet seam-side down. Cook on medium heat until the undersides are well-browned and crisp, 6 to 7 minutes.
  2. Turn the apricots over and continue to cook until browned on the bottom, 2 to 3 minutes more. Add the maple syrup, vinegar and a few grinds of pepper and cook, shaking the skillet to coat, until the liquid has reduced and the apricots are glossy and browned all over, about 1 minute more. Transfer to a small plate and sprinkle with the chives. Serve warm or at room temperature.
